Product Description




Product Description

Strong, durable, dustproof and waterproof, ergonomic design
Dual CPU codec to ensure reliable data communication
Well-designed joystick, life of 1 million times
Smart key, perfect backup capability
Real-time active control, in line with EU standards
Up to 60 IO inputs, 10 proportional inputs
Optional bus output type, customizable feedback content
Operating elements ≤4 universal joysticks or ≤10-way proportional joysticks; ≤8 side key switches; 1 emergency stop switch; multiple toggle switches; rotary switch; push button switch, etc.
Standard functions smart key; automatic shutdown
Optional functions ID card; N to N function (N ≤ 8); collision shutdown; tilt shutdown; weightlessness shutdown; 2.2-inch display; 4.0-inch display; 5.0-inch display; wired control; panel lighting; video monitoring; fingerprint recognition

Exploring the Unmatched Benefits of Industrial Remote Control

Remote controls have become indispensable in our daily lives, each household housing a variety of these convenient devices. However, unlike the familiar civilian remote controls, industrial remote controls remain less explored by the general populace.

An industrial remote control is a sophisticated device that leverages radio transmission to facilitate precise, remote management of industrial machinery. This advanced system is comprised of a portable, handheld or waist-mounted transmitter paired with a resilient receiver securely affixed to the machinery. The operator inputs commands via the transmitter's ergonomic operation panel, subsequently digitizing, encoding, and encrypting these instructions. They are wirelessly communicated to a robust receiving system, where they undergo decoding and conversion, seamlessly translating them back into control commands to adeptly manage a diverse range of mechanical equipment.

Industrial remote controls boast superior technical specifications including heightened accuracy, sensitivity, seamless signal continuity, robust anti-interference capabilities, extensive remote control range, and remarkable waterproof and dustproof protection. They are designed to endure extreme temperature fluctuations, corrosive substances, and various harsh environments. These attributes distinctly set industrial remote controls apart from their civilian counterparts, ensuring their indispensability in demanding industrial settings.

Industrial remote controls find essential applications in sectors reliant on cranes like metallurgy, shipbuilding, container terminals, warehousing, machinery manufacturing, chemicals, papermaking, and construction engineering. They empower operations to be conducted remotely, with effective coverage extending from a 100-meter radius to several kilometers, unaffected by physical obstructions. Operators benefit from the freedom of movement, carrying lightweight transmitters to select optimal, safe vantage points for operation, thereby eliminating risks associated with restricted visibility, cumbersome line control, hostile environments, or inefficient communication. This innovation not only elevates safety standards but also significantly boosts production efficiency.

What are the ADVANTAGES of industrial remote controls?
★ Slash manufacturing and maintenance costs: Transitioning from traditional cabs to remote control systems has long been achieved and is now a staple in the production process.
★ Enhance safety and reliability: By eliminating the command link, potential misunderstandings due to faulty communication are averted. Operators, stationed at optimal angles, gain clearer insights into the hoisted items' status, thus sidestepping the dangers encountered in cabs during adverse weather, and preventing miscommunications during high-altitude tasks that could lead to avoidable mishaps.
★ Elevate the operating environment: Operators can strategically choose safer angles, steering clear of positions with compromised visibility and severe pollution, effectively shielding themselves from harmful gases.
★ Conserve human resources: Taking the bridge crane as a prime example, one individual can effortlessly manage the operation, mooring, lifting, and unloading, all independently, without any external command.
★ Amplify work efficiency: Operators can make autonomous decisions, leading to enhanced accuracy and operational fluidity. Freed from the confines of cab restrictions and cumbersome operating lines, operators avoid discomfort caused by extreme cab temperatures, thereby boosting morale and operational productivity.

As industrial remote controls permeate various sectors, their advantages are becoming increasingly pronounced, driving a new era of efficiency and safety in industrial operations.
